NC State sits at 2–0 after back-to-back comeback wins, and now the Wolfpack face their first conference test tonight on the road at Wake Forest.

Head coach Dave Doeren emphasized how his team has responded in critical moments in the first two weeks. “The players were great. Coaches made really good corrections and the players understood what we needed to do to get the game back on our side,” he said. “It builds confidence…we’ve been tested twice and we finished both times. That belief is real.”

The Wolfpack offense has played sharp, mistake-free football. In the win over Virginia (designated as a nonconference matchup), NC State committed no turnovers, allowed no sacks, and drew no penalties. Quarterback CJ Bailey continued his steady start with a scrambling touchdown and efficient command of the offense. “He sees things, he understands the system, he’s in command of the guys around him,” Doeren said. “It’s an extension of the head coach when you have a quarterback like that.”

On defense, NC State showed growth after halftime, locking down in the red zone and producing stops when it mattered. Doeren praised his group’s stamina and toughness, “They are bowing up and showing mental toughness.”

Now the focus turns to Wake Forest, where a 2–0 Demon Deacons team awaits behind star tailback Demond Claiborne and a physical dual-threat quarterback. “It’s a rivalry game, and they’ve got explosive players,” Doeren said. “You’ve got to be really disciplined in everything that we do.”

Kickoff is scheduled for 7:30 p.m. ET. The game will be broadcast on ESPN.
